Installation

PurrDiction is an addon to PurrNet. Install a compatible PurrNet version first; PurrDiction's package does not declare PurrNet as an automatic UPM dependency.

Supported Unity versions

The package compiles on Unity 2022 as well as Unity 6: the runtime and prebuilt components select the correct Rigidbody velocity API and physics material type for the editor version automatically.

The prebuilt sample components do not require the Input System package. When the new Input System is not enabled, they fall back to the legacy Input Manager for keyboard polling.

Install from Git

In Unity, open Window > Package Manager, select Add package from git URL, and use the stable branch:

https://github.com/PurrNet/PurrDiction.git?path=/Assets/PurrDiction#release

Use the development branch only when you intentionally need unreleased work:

https://github.com/PurrNet/PurrDiction.git?path=/Assets/PurrDiction#dev

Git must be installed and available to Unity. Restart Unity and Unity Hub after installing Git.

Install from OpenUPM

PurrDiction's package name is dev.purrnet.purrdiction:

openupm add dev.purrnet.purrdiction

You can also configure the OpenUPM scoped registry and add the package by name through Unity's Package Manager.

Configure a scene

  1. Add one Prediction Manager to each scene that owns a predicted world.
  2. Select which Built In Systems the scene needs: hierarchy, players, time, random, and 2D or 3D physics.
  3. If using Unity physics, enable the matching flag in Physics Provider as well as the matching built-in physics system.
  4. Choose whether view updates run in Update, LateUpdate, or not at all with Update View Mode.
  5. Create a Predicted Prefabs asset from Assets > Create > PurrNet > Purrdiction > PredictedPrefabs and assign it to the manager when the hierarchy will create predicted prefabs.

The Predicted Prefabs asset can scan a selected folder, or all of Assets, for prefabs containing a PredictedIdentity. Each entry can optionally use pooling and a warmup count.

Both Built In Systems > Physics 3D/2D and the corresponding Physics Provider flag are required for PurrDiction-managed Unity physics. Do not drive predicted physics from FixedUpdate; the Prediction Manager advances physics during its tick simulation.

First verification

Enter Play Mode as host and confirm that:

  • The Prediction Manager spawns without registration errors.
  • Any predicted prefab used by PredictedHierarchy.Create appears in the assigned Predicted Prefabs asset.
  • Input and simulation callbacks run at the PurrNet tick rate.
  • A remote client receives verified frames and corrects after simulated latency or packet loss.
